Classic Spaghetti with Tomato Sauce

Created by: Nathanielmc1

Ingredients

  • 8 oz spaghetti
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1/2 onion, finely chopped
  • 1 can (14 oz) crushed tomatoes
  • 1 tsp dried oregano
  • 1/2 tsp red pepper flakes
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h basil leaves for garnish
  • Grated Parmesan cheese for serving

Instructions

  •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Add 8 oz of spaghetti and cook according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
  • In a large skillet, heat 2 tbsp of olive oil over medium heat. Add 3 cloves of minced garlic and 1/2 finely chopped onion. Cook until the onion is translucent and the garlic is fragrant, about 3-4 minutes.
  • Stir in 1 can of crushed tomatoes, 1 tsp of dried oregano, and 1/2 tsp of red pepper flakes.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Simmer for 10 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• Add the cooked spaghetti to the skillet and toss to coat the pasta with the tomato sauce.
  • Divide the spaghetti among serving plates. Garnish with fresh basil leaves and serve with grated Parmesan cheese on top.

Spaghetti, a beloved Italian pasta, has a rich history dating back to the 12th century. Originating in Sicily, it gained popularity throughout Italy and beyond. The dish became a staple in Italian cuisine, with chefs in regions like Naples and Bologna adding their own unique twists. Today, the best spaghetti can be found in the heart of Italy, where traditional recipes are honored. The key to a perfect plate of spaghetti lies in the quality of the pasta and the sauce. While the classic spaghetti with marinara sauce is iconic, variations like spaghetti carbonara and aglio e olio offer delightful alternatives.
